When Winston reflects on a coral paperweight, he sees it as a preserved world for him and Julia, separate from the Party’s reach. Its later destruction symbolizes the fragility of personal freedom. What literary device is used here?
What is Symbolism?
“The paperweight was the room he was in, and the coral was Julia’s life and his own, fixed in a sort of eternity at the heart of the crystal.”
